հաշվետվությունների հարցում API միջոցով

Տվյալներն ուղարկվում են իրական ժամանակում և վերբեռնվում պատվերի ավարտից հետո։

Հարցումներ - ոչ ավելի, քան րոպեում մեկ անգամ:

Տոկենի (token) ստացում

Տրվում է պահանջի դեպքում: Տոկեն ստանալու համար դիմեք ձեր մենեջերին: Տոկենը ուժի մեջ է 6 ամիս: Նույն ցանցում նոր Տոկենի թողարկումն անվավեր է դարձնում նախորդը:

Պատվերի արտահանում

Հարցում

pickerapp.eda.yandex.ru/partner/v1/orders/export

Պատասխանի օրինակ

orders.csv

Պատվերի ապրանքների մասին տեղեկատվության արտահանում

Հարցում։

pickerapp.eda.yandex.ru/partner/v1/orders/positions/export

Պատասխանի օրինակ ։

order-positions.csv

Հավաքագրողի հերթափոխի արտահանում

Հարցում

pickerapp.eda.yandex.ru/partner/v1/shifts/export

Պատասղանի օրինակ

shifts.csv

Հասանելի ֆիլտրեր

Ուշադրություն

Բոլոր ֆիլտրերը պարամետրեր են հարցման տողում

Պատվերի տեղեկատվության արտահանման համար օգտագործում է նույն ֆիլտրերը.

  • startDate — ամսաթիվը, որից (ներառյալ) պատվերները կբեռնվեն.
  • endDate — Ամսաթիվ, մինչ որը կբեռնվեն պատվերները;
  • orderId — Պատվերի ներքին ID;
  • displayId — Պատվերի № հավաքագրողի համար;
  • pickerId — պատվերի համար նշանակված հավաքագրողի ներքին ID;
  • storeId* — Խանութի ներքին ID;
  • cityId* — քաղաքի նեքին ID;
  • logisticServiceId* — Հավաքագրողի առաքման ծառայության ներքին ID;
  • integrationStatus — ինտեգրումից ստացված պատվերի կարգավիճակը. Հնարավոր կարգավիճակներ: created / accepted / handed_over_for_picking / handed_over_for_delivery / delivered / canceled;
  • status - Պատվերի կարգավիճակ, որով հավաքագրողը ավարտել է աշխատանքը: done – փոխանցվել է առաքիչին, canceled - չեղարկված.

Ֆիլտրեր՝ հերթափոխի արտահանման համար

  • pickerId — Հավաքագրողի ներքին ID
  • storeId* — Խանութի ներքին ID;
  • start — ըստ մեկնարկի ժամանակի: տրամադրվում է գրառումները, որոնց մեկնարկի ժամը նշվածից ոչ շուտ է (կամ ավելի ուշ);
  • end — հերթափոխի ժամանակի ավարտին. տրամադրվում է գրառումները, որոնց մեկնարկի ժամը նշվածից ոչ շուտ է (կամ ավելի ուշ);
  • isActive — միայն ակտիվ կամ ոչ ակտիվ հերթափոխեր.
  • logisticServiceId* — առաքման ծառայության
  • cityId* — ըստ քաղաքի նեքին ID;
  • status: created / activated / finished / break — Ըստ հերթափոխի կարգավիճակի.

(*) — ֆիլտրերի արժեքները տեսանելի չեն ադմինկայի ինտերֆեյսից, ստացեք հարցումը api picker-backend ում.

Բոլոր հնարավոր ֆիլտրերով հարցման օրինակ՝ օգտագործելով բողոքների արտահանման օրինակը ( curl ֆորմատով )

curl --location --request GET 'picker-api.delivery-club.ru2/partner/v1/orders/complaints/export?startDate=2021-
12-12&endDate=2021-12-18&orderId=12345678&displayId=12-3456-
7890&pickerId=1234&storeId=1234&cityId=123&logisticServiceId=1&integrationStatus=canceled&status=done' \
--header 'Authorization: Bearer %token_stand_in%'